## What is Swing Trading ADA on Bybit?
Swing trading aims to capture short-term price “swings” within larger trends, holding positions from minutes to hours. When applied to Cardano (ADA) on Bybit – a leading crypto derivatives exchange – traders leverage:
– Ultra-fast order execution for rapid trades
– Up to 25x leverage to amplify gains on small moves
– 24/7 market access to capitalize on ADA’s volatility
Unlike scalping, 1-minute swing trading focuses on catching multi-candle momentum shifts rather than single-tick profits.

## Core Elements of a Winning 1-Minute ADA Swing Strategy
### Trend Identification Tools
– **EMA Ribbon**: Use 5, 9, and 20-period Exponential Moving Averages. Trades only occur when all EMAs align (e.g., stacked upward for longs)
– **Volume Spikes**: Confirm breakouts with 150%+ average volume on the entry candle
### Entry Triggers
– **Breakout Pullback**: Enter when price retraces to EMA support after breaking a swing high/low
– **RSI Divergence**: Spot hidden reversals when RSI (period 6) diverges from price action
### Exit Rules
– **Profit Targets**: 1:2 risk-reward minimum; secure 50% at 1R, trail balance
– **Stop-Loss Placement**: Fixed 0.5% below entry for longs (above for shorts)
## Step-by-Step Trade Execution on Bybit
1. **Chart Setup**: Open Bybit ADA/USDT perpetual chart with 1m candles, EMAs (5,9,20), RSI, and volume
2. **Signal Confirmation**: Wait for EMA alignment + volume-backed breakout candle
3. **Entry**: Place limit order at 50% retracement of breakout candle
4. **Risk Management**: Set stop-loss 0.5% from entry; max 1% account risk per trade
5. **Exit**: Sell 50% at 1% profit, move SL to breakeven, trail remainder with 3-bar EMA
## Risk Management for High-Frequency Trading
– **Position Sizing**: Never risk >1% of capital per trade
– **Session Limits**: Max 3 consecutive losing trades triggers a mandatory break
– **Volatility Filter**: Avoid trading during ADA news events or <0.8% average candle range
– **Leverage Discipline**: Use ≤10x leverage until consistently profitable
